Your Mechatronic Engineering degree from The University of Manchester will open a world of opportunity, and the skills you develop will be sought across a wide range of industries. 

There is a shortage of electronic and electrical engineers, and our graduates are in demand in this highly employable profession. EEE is a global market today, opportunities truly are global. Our graduates have been prepared for opportunities such as:

  • Developing microcontroller-based embedded systems
  • Developing robotics 
  • Integrating renewable energy sources
  • Designing associated power conversion systems
  • Developing automation and control systems 
  • Designing automotive electronics
  • Designing electrical machines
  • Developing guidance and control systems for unmanned intelligent underwater, or ground and aerial vehicles.
